The Denver Broncos today signed seventh-round draft pick Melvin Bratton to a one-year contract after resolving a dispute over the length of the pact. Broncos General Manager John Beake said Bratton received a salary comparable to a mid-round pick and a hefty incentive package. The terms of the contract were not disclosed. Bratton, the all-time leader in career touchdowns at the University of Miami, injured his knee in the 1987 Orange Bowl, and that kept him out of action last year.
